Beyond the Bouquet: The Anatomy of a Versatile Digital Asset

What you’re looking at here is more than a collection of pretty pictures. This is a curated set of four distinct, hand-drawn (and then digitally refined) floral compositions, each designed with specific design applications in mind. The set includes a corner piece peony, perfect for framing text; a single peony with a flower spray, ideal as a focal point; a classic bunch of roses and gypsophila; and a full wreath of roses, which works beautifully as a border or standalone graphic. The true value lies in their preparation. Delivered as high-resolution PNGs (with transparent backgrounds) and JPEGs (with clean white backgrounds) at 300 DPI, they’re print-ready from the moment you download them. The dimensions are generous, ranging from 1577 to 3300 pixels, ensuring they hold their detail whether you’re scaling them down for a business card or blowing them up for a poster.

Making It Work: Tips for Seamless Integration

To get the most out of assets like these, a thoughtful approach is needed. First, consider the overall tone of your project. These elegant florals have a romantic, refined personality. They pair beautifully with classic serif fonts for a traditional feel or with clean, modern sans-serifs for a contemporary contrast. The key is to let the florals complement your typography, not compete with it.

Color is your next lever. The illustrations are provided in black and white, which is a strategic advantage. You can easily recolor them in your design software to match your brand’s palette. A soft blush pink, a deep forest green, or even a metallic gold can completely change the mood, making them incredibly adaptable to different themes and seasons.

Always be mindful of scale and placement. A large, full wreath might overwhelm a small business card, but it could be stunning as the central design on a wedding website. Conversely, the single peony spray might be just the right touch of detail for a letterhead. Play with opacity, too. Reducing the opacity can create a beautiful, subtle watermark effect for backgrounds.

Finally, while the commercial license typically allows for use in end products for sale (like printed invitations or merchandise you sell), it’s always a responsible practice to double-check the specific license terms provided with your download. Understanding what you can and cannot do with the assets protects your business and ensures you’re using them ethically.
